Where does “মাস” come from?

মাস (Bengali) comes from Magadhi Prakrit ???, from Sanskrit मास, from Proto-Indo-European mḗms, from Proto-Indo-European mems-, from Proto-Indo-European me-ms-, from Proto-Indo-European mes-.

মাস (Bengali): month; flesh, meat
